On Thu, Jul 31, 2014 at 7:37 AM, Paolo Bonzini <address@hidden> wrote:
> Il 30/07/2014 19:15, Ming Lei ha scritto:
>> On Wed, Jul 30, 2014 at 9:45 PM, Paolo Bonzini <address@hidden> wrote:
>>> Il 30/07/2014 13:39, Ming Lei ha scritto:
>>>> This patch introduces several APIs for supporting bypass qemu coroutine
>>>> in case of being not necessary and for performance's sake.
>>>
>>> No, this is wrong. Dataplane *must* use the same code as non-dataplane,
>>> anything else is a step backwards.
>>
>> As we saw, coroutine has brought up performance regression
>> on dataplane, and it isn't necessary to use co in some cases, is it?
>
> Yes, and it's not necessary on non-dataplane either. It's not necessary
> on virtio-scsi, and it will not be necessary on virtio-scsi dataplane
> either.
It is good to know these cases, so they might benefit from this patch
in future too, :-)
>>> If you want to bypass coroutines, bdrv_aio_readv/writev must detect the
>>> conditions that allow doing that and call the bdrv_aio_readv/writev
>>> directly.
>>
>> That is easy to detect, please see the 5th patch.
>
> No, that's not enough. Dataplane right now prevents block jobs, but
> that's going to change and it could require coroutines even for raw devices.
Could you explain it a bit why co is required for raw devices in future?
If some cases for not requiring co can be detected beforehand, these
patches are useful, IMO.
>>> To begin with, have you benchmarked QEMU and can you provide a trace of
>>> *where* the coroutine overhead lies?
>>
>> I guess it may be caused by the stack switch, at least in one of
>> my box, bypassing co can improve throughput by ~7%, and by
>> ~15% in another box.
>
> No guesses please. Actually that's also my guess, but since you are
> submitting the patch you must do better and show profiles where stack
> switching disappears after the patches.
OK, no problem, I will provide some profile result.
